On the Wednesday before NYFW, Chloe and Halle Bailey hosted a cocktail and intimate dinner celebrating their new Be Love campaign with the jewelry mega-brand. The campaign features Pandora's three new global ambassadors: the dynamic sister duo, alongside actor, author, and advocate Selma Blair, celebrating the transformative power of love in all its forms.
"Since we were kids, my sister and I have admired that everyone loved Pandora, and Pandora loved us right back. So whether it was about celebrating a precious memory with a charm, finding a great gift for each other, or just reminding your sister that you've got her back," Chloe and Halle said to fellow guests.
Partygoers gathered for cocktails at Verōnika restaurant's ornate bar while enjoying a live DJ set by Gonnie Garko and wandering into the dining area, where more surprises awaited them. The restaurant transformed to evoke a Valentine's Day ambiance draped in pale pinks, blossoming bouquets of fuchsia, and red florals, with heart-shaped pandora boxes at each seat. Inside, guests enjoyed the chance to pick their favorite Pandora bracelet or necklace from a custom engraving station, personalizing locket charms. After cocktails, party-goers sat for a 3-course French service-style dinner.
